Jamaica’s men’s team finished sixth in the 4X400m relay to bring the curtains down at the 2020 Tokyo Olympic Games a short while ago.
The quartet of Demish Gaye, Christopher Taylor, Jaheel Hyde, and Nathon Allen clocked 2:58.76 minutes to finish outside the medals after failing to recover from a fairly slow start.
United States won in 2:55.70, ahead of Netherlands, which clocked a national record of 2:57.18.
Botswana were third in an area record of 2:57.27.
